Tejano Singer Jimmy González, Founder Of El Grupo Mazz Passed Away In San Antonio

González died after being hospitalized with heart problems in San Antonio.

San Antonio, Texas - On Wednesday, Tejano singer Jimmy González, 67, originally from Brownsville, the founder of El Grupo Mazz died at around 9:57 a.m. at a San Antonio hospital, according Eloy Leija, the promotions managet from Freddie Records who González recorded his Tejano style songs and hits in the last 20 years with more than 36 years in the music career. González was suffering from medical issues.
An emergency first responders crew was dispatched to where González had a seizure and his heart had stopped. Emergency personnel were able to revived González and was taken to a hospital in San Antonio where he later passed away.
González's low blood sugar level on early Wednesday might have triggered heart failure.

In early February, González, the lead singer and 8 Time Grammy Award Winner for the Tejano style Grupo Mazz was also hospitalized after coming severely ill and was having a hard time breathing due to a bad case of the flu.
González was scheduled to perform at the Outta Town Dance Hall in Mission at a pre-Super Bowl Dance when he got sick with the flu. The management at the dance hall says that González became ill during the performance and could not perform as programmed. 
In 1998, both Joe Lopez and Jimmy González, the other co-founder Mazz split and two Tejano bands continued to perform Tejano style music venue as Jimmy González y Grupo Mazz and Joe Lopez y La Nueva Imagen Mazz. La Nueva Imagen Mazz band later phased out.
González from the Grupo Mazz has three of his sons in the group. Grupo Mazz is credited for modernizing the Tejano style of music.
